Transaction 197021514ca290256dbf6a3204017c0ec429d6114be8b0c43b189e7c7966b861

1 Input
2 Outputs
  • 197021514ca290256dbf6a3204017c0ec429d6114be8b0c43b189e7c7966b861:0
  • value  57401424
    address  3QAhiHKzcegbR7bDksk33SPTgVEexaVHD7
  • 197021514ca290256dbf6a3204017c0ec429d6114be8b0c43b189e7c7966b861:1
  • value  3270604
    address  31sK7jShE13xjL3bMAEvhXeJmybSoM2skg